[前][次][番号順一覧][スレッド一覧]

mysql:15684

From: 佐藤 教子 <佐藤 教子 <kyksatoh@xxxxxxxxxx>>
Date: Fri, 24 Feb 2012 00:49:39 +0900
Subject: [mysql 15684] Re: [mysql 15677] RE: [mysql 15675] Re: [mysql 15672] Re: MySQL5.5.20の文字コードの設定方法について

佐藤です。あきらさん、ありがとうございます。

>>     <data-sources>
>>       <data-source type="org.apache.commons.dbcp.BasicDataSource">
>>         <set-property property="driverClassName"
>> value="com.mysql.jdbc.Driver" />
>>         <set-property property="url"
>> value="jdbc:mysql://localhost/aliishop?useUnicode=true&amp;characterEn
>> coding=sjis"
>> />
>>         <set-property property="username" value="root" />
>>         <set-property property="password" value="1028" />
>>       </data-source>
>>     </data-sources>
>
> 横から失礼します
> そもそも本当にSJISですか?
> 上記はクライアントがUnicodeでサーバーがSJISの設定ですよね?

はい、元々はWindows-31Jにしていましたが、sjisに変更しました。

> サーバーOS自体の文字コード  = cp932
> サーバーDB上に保存してる文字コード = utf8
> クライアント自体の文字コード  =cp932
> ブラウザに出力している文字コード SJIS

かと思っております。

> サーバー側の設定は無指定で、クライアントからの実行時に
> set names を実行してからselectを実行して、どの文字コードだと
> 化けないのかを確かめたほうがよいと思います
>
> set names utf8;
> SELECT 'あ';
> SELECT * from test; -- 日本語が戻るテーブル
>
> set names sjis;
> SELECT  'あ';
> SELECT * from test; -- 日本語が戻るテーブル
>
> set names ujis;
> SELECT  'あ';
> SELECT * from test; -- 日本語が戻るテーブル

これは、コマンドプロンプトで実行するということでしょうか?
そうだとして、SELECT  'あ'; を実行する前に'あ'をtestテーブルにINSERTするという事でしょうか?

すみませんが、ご返事いただけますと幸いです。

Kyoko Satoh 


[前][次][番号順一覧][スレッド一覧]

     15659 2012-01-26 07:06 [とみたまさひろ <tomm] デブサミ2012                            
     15660 2012-01-26 11:35 ┗[Makoto Akai <akai@xx]                                       
     15661 2012-01-27 01:53  ┗[とみたまさひろ <tomm]                                     
     15666 2012-02-21 00:09   ┗[佐藤 教子 <kyksatoh@] MySQL5.5.20の文字コードの設定方法について
     15667 2012-02-21 00:24    ┗[佐藤 教子 <kyksatoh@]                                 
     15668 2012-02-21 00:50     ┣[<shin-1@xxxxxxxxxx> ]                               
   @ 15669 2012-02-21 02:35     ┃┗[Akio Imai <suzuro204] Re: [mysql 15666] MySQL5.5.20の文字コードの設定方法について
     15670 2012-02-21 08:45     ┃ ┣[佐藤 教子 <kyksatoh@] Re: [mysql 15669] Re: [mysql 15666] MySQL5.5.20の文字コードの設定方法について
     15671 2012-02-21 09:16     ┃ ┃┗[<kouji@xxxxxxxxxx>  ] Re: MySQL5.5.20の文字コードの設定方法について
     15674 2012-02-21 17:44     ┃ ┃ ┗[佐藤 教子 <kyksatoh@]                       
   @ 15676 2012-02-21 18:56     ┃ ┗[Yuuki Shimizu <y.shi] Re: MySQL5.5.20の文字コードの設定方法について
     15683 2012-02-24 00:10     ┃  ┗[佐藤 教子 <kyksatoh@] Re: [mysql 15676] Re: MySQL5.5.20の文字コードの設定方法について
     15672 2012-02-21 09:35     ┗[Mikiya Okuno <mikiya]                               
     15675 2012-02-21 18:28      ┗[佐藤 教子 <kyksatoh@] Re: [mysql 15672] Re: MySQL5.5.20の文字コードの設定方法について
     15677 2012-02-21 23:41       ┣["akira" <akirainfoml] RE: [mysql 15675] Re: [mysql 15672] Re: MySQL5.5.20の文字コードの設定方法について
->   15684 2012-02-24 00:49       ┃┗[佐藤 教子 <kyksatoh@] Re: [mysql 15677] RE: [mysql 15675] Re: [mysql 15672] Re: MySQL5.5.20の文字コードの設定方法について
     15687 2012-02-27 00:56       ┃ ┗[佐藤 教子 <kyksatoh@] Re: [mysql 15684] Re: [mysql 15677] RE: [mysql 15675] Re: [mysql 15672] Re: MySQL5.5.20の文字コードの設定方法について
     15678 2012-02-22 09:01       ┗[Etsuo SUMIYA <sumiya] Re: MySQL5.5.20の文字コードの設定方法について